How to Hide a Specific Folder on Android Using Calculator Hide App

Your Android gallery is full of folders — Camera, Screenshots, WhatsApp Images, Downloads. Some of them contain files you’d rather keep private. Calculator Hide App lets you pull an entire folder into your encrypted vault at once, removing it from your gallery and locking it behind your PIN.

How Folder Hiding Works in Calculator Hide App

When you import a folder into Calculator Hide App, all files in that folder are encrypted and moved into the vault. The original folder in your gallery is emptied — the files are no longer visible in your gallery app, Google Photos, or any file manager. They exist only inside the encrypted vault.

Step-by-Step: Import a Folder into the Vault

  1. Open Calculator Hide App and enter your PIN.
  2. Inside the vault, tap the ”+” button to add new content.
  3. Select “Import from Gallery” or “Import from Files.”
  4. Navigate to the folder you want to hide. On Android, this lets you browse your internal storage directories.
  5. Select all files in the folder. Most gallery pickers let you tap a folder to select all its contents at once.
  6. Tap “Import” or “Add to Vault.”
  7. Calculator Hide App encrypts each file and moves it into the vault. Depending on folder size this may take a moment.
  8. Once complete, you will be asked whether to delete the originals. Tap “Delete Originals” to remove them from the gallery.

Organising Your Vault by Folder

Inside Calculator Hide App, you can create named folders within the vault to mirror the organisation you had in your gallery. Tap “New Folder,” name it, and move your imported files into it. This keeps things organised, especially if you’re hiding content from multiple sources.

Hiding WhatsApp Media Folders

WhatsApp saves every photo and video you receive to a folder called “WhatsApp Images” and “WhatsApp Video” on your device. If you want to hide this media, follow the steps above and select those specific folders. Once imported, the WhatsApp media folder in your gallery will be empty while your files remain safely inside the vault.

Hiding Screenshots

Screenshots are stored in the “Screenshots” folder on most Android devices. Importing this folder into the vault removes all screenshots from your gallery immediately. Useful if your screenshots contain sensitive information like bank details, messages, or addresses.

Frequently Asked Questions

Can I hide a folder without deleting the originals?

Yes. When prompted after import, choose “Keep Originals” instead of “Delete Originals.” The files will exist in both the vault and your gallery. This is useful if you want encrypted copies while keeping the originals accessible.

Will new files added to the original folder be automatically hidden?

No. Calculator Hide App imports a folder at a specific point in time. New files added to the original folder location after the import are not automatically moved to the vault. You would need to import them manually.
